Maxim Crane Works selects ADP Payroll for Payroll

In 2012, Maxim Crane Works, a United States based Professional Services organization with 3000 employees and revenues of $902M selected ADP Payroll for Payroll while displacing Legacy, and integrating with the existing systems being used.
